About Jumon

Jumon occupies a spot in St. George's Market. It prepares food using modern techniques and local ingredients. It isn't a typical market eatery. Jumon offers a restaurant setting, operating within the busy market. The restaurant demonstrates its quality with every dish. This includes the produce it selects and the cocktails it mixes. Its location, just steps from the historic market stalls, suits a meal after exploring the local crafts and produce. Whether a Belfast local or a visitor, Jumon provides a meal in one of the city's more active locations. The warm atmosphere and attentive service attract patrons. Booking is often necessary, particularly during peak market hours. Jumon consistently ranks among the better restaurants near St. George's Market. It serves food.

Signature Dishes

Must Try

Pan-Seared Scallops

£24

Fresh scallops served with cauliflower purée, crispy pancetta, and brown butter sauce.

Slow-Cooked Pork Belly

£22

Tender pork belly with apple chutney, roasted vegetables, and a rich jus.

Seafood Risotto

£26

Creamy risotto with a medley of fresh seafood, Parmesan cheese, and herbs.
